Frequently Asked Questions

How much does tree removal typically cost in Jacksonville?
Costs vary quite a bit depending on tree height, location, and how close it is to structures. In Jacksonville, most single-tree removals for a mid-sized tree run somewhere between $300 and $900, though large oaks near a home can cost more.
Do you need a permit to remove a tree in Jacksonville?
Jacksonville has a tree removal ordinance that may require a permit for protected or heritage trees, especially on properties within city limits. Your service provider can often advise you on this, but it's worth checking with the City of Jacksonville's Tree Conservation office before scheduling large removals.
How soon can I get emergency storm cleanup after a bad storm?
Most Jacksonville tree services prioritize storm calls and try to respond within 24 to 48 hours for urgent situations involving trees on homes or blocking driveways. During major weather events like a tropical storm, wait times can stretch longer due to high call volumes across the city.
Is stump grinding included with tree removal?
Not always. Many companies price stump grinding separately because it requires different equipment. It's worth asking upfront so you know exactly what the quote includes and can budget accordingly.
Are tree service companies in Jacksonville insured?
Reputable providers carry both liability insurance and workers' compensation. Always ask for proof of insurance before work starts, since tree removal involves real risks to property and workers.
What's the best time of year for tree trimming in Florida?
Late fall through early spring is generally ideal in Jacksonville because trees are less stressed during cooler months and it's outside peak hurricane season. That said, dead or hazardous branches should be addressed any time they pose a risk.
